Machine Build Tech(Mechanics/Fitters/Toolmakers)

Job Purpose

To build machines used in the production of medical devices.

Hours of work:

Successful candidates have their choice of the below shifts:

Mon-Thursday OR Tuesday-Friday. Start and finish times are very flexible. The suggestion is 6.15am-4.30pm and we can work around individual needs. There is also the OPTION to do six hours overtime on a Saturday at overtime rates.

Job Purpose

To build and support equipment for the production of medical devices.

 Key Responsibilities

  • Required to take a leading or supporting role in the mechanical or electrical build or upgrade of equipment. This person needs to show ownership / accountability for builds and upgrades assigned.
  • Provide technical leadership on equipment build related issues.
  • May be required to perform role of a mentor to new hires / apprentices
  • Work closely with  design team to ensure that the equipment is built according to specifications and is properly handed over to commissioning or manufacturing.
  • Must be competent in reading mechanical and electrical drawing packages
  • Knowledge of pneumatics and competent in reading pneumatic schematics
  • Identify build issues with drawing package and relay information to engineer
  • As part of the build team, this person is expected to work closely with internal resources to complete equipment related projects.
  • Communicates any concerns about work process regarding environmental impact, health or safety issues to their Manager / Supervisor.
  • Build Quality into all aspects of work by maintaining compliance to all quality requirements
  • Actively participate in departmental and plant Continuous Improvement through participation in Value Improvement Projects and Lean Business Process Projects as well as departmental standards etc.
  • In all actions, demonstrates a primary commitment to patient safety and product quality by maintaining compliance to the Quality Policy and all other documented quality processes and procedures.

 

 

Qualifications & Experience

  • Must be qualified electrician or toolmaker or mechanic
  • Experience of building to drawings
  • Good technical capabilities, communication skills, teamwork abilities and initiative.
  • Proven ability to work well as part of a team & on own with minimum supervision
  • Good communication skills combined with an imaginative and creative approach to problem solving.
